WebJun 7, 2013 · A molecule with a large chain length experiences stronger London Dispersion Forces. The reason is that longer molecules have more places where they can be attracted to other molecules. This is the reason why pentane (longer chain molecule) experiences stronger intermolecular forces of attraction than methane. WebOil is a non-polar molecule, while water is a polar molecule. While all molecules are attracted to each other, some attractions are stronger than others. Non-polar molecules are attracted through a London dispersion attraction; polar molecules are attracted through both the London dispersion force and the stronger dipole-dipole attraction.
